Transaction e4e1038ee8caed6820fa0a18d3dce5e93e203a5b7238669a51acbd947e6124b0
1 Input
1 Output
-
e4e1038ee8caed6820fa0a18d3dce5e93e203a5b7238669a51acbd947e6124b0:0
- value
- 3496656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7d27ed35499d67660132714db08c304fc2a0432 OP_EQUAL
- address
- 3QHNzQMeP45bvzRafHSE16h3AK1X1xJv4q